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Powiat Oświęcimski, Poland
- Auschwitz-Birkenau Memorial and Museum: A sobering but essential visit, this site serves as a powerful reminder of the Holocaust. Allow ample time for reflection.
- Oświęcim Market Square: Escape the weight of history with a stroll through this charming town square. Enjoy the architecture and soak up the local atmosphere.
- Wieliczka Salt Mine (a short trip from Oświęcim): While technically outside Powiat Oświęcimski, this UNESCO World Heritage site is easily accessible and offers a fascinating underground world to explore.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Powiat Oświęcimski, Poland
Polish cuisine is hearty and delicious! Look for pierogi (dumplings), żurek (sour rye soup), and bigos (hunter's stew). Don't be afraid to venture beyond the tourist areas to find authentic local eateries.

Best Time to Visit Powiat Oświęcimski, Poland
Summer (June-August) offers warm weather ideal for exploring the countryside. Sh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) offer pleasant temperatures with fewer crowds. Winter can be cold, but offers a different kind of beauty.
